Periodized strength training is a systematic approach used by power athletes to optimize performance and prevent injuries. By cycling through different training phases, athletes can progressively build strength, power, and endurance while allowing adequate recovery.
What Is Periodized Strength Training?
Periodized training involves dividing the training program into specific phases or cycles, each with distinct goals and training intensities. These phases typically include hypertrophy, strength, and power, designed to target different physiological adaptations.
The Science Behind Periodization
Research shows that periodization enhances performance by preventing plateaus and overtraining. It allows athletes to peak at the right time, such as during competitions. The structured variation in training stimuli helps in optimizing neuromuscular adaptations and hormonal responses.
Physiological Benefits
- Improved muscle strength and power
- Enhanced neuromuscular efficiency
- Reduced risk of overtraining and injury
- Better recovery and adaptation
Implementing Periodized Training
Effective periodized programs are tailored to the athlete’s goals, experience level, and competition schedule. Typical cycles last from 4 to 12 weeks, with each phase emphasizing different training variables such as volume, intensity, and exercise selection.
Example of a Basic Cycle
- Hypertrophy Phase: Focus on higher volume with moderate weights to increase muscle size.
- Strength Phase: Lower volume with heavier weights to build maximal strength.
- Power Phase: Explosive movements with moderate weights to develop power.
Progression and variation are key. Adjusting training variables ensures continuous adaptation and prevents stagnation. Regular assessments help in fine-tuning the program for optimal results.
